Regular Season Round 26: Saint-Chamond - Caen 72-64
Date: April 12, 2019
Very expected game when 17th ranked Caen (7-19) was defeated on the road by fifth ranked Saint Chamond (17-9) 72-64 on Friday. Saint Chamond outrebounded Caen 40-25 including 29 on the defensive glass. They looked well-organized offensively handing out 26 assists. The best player for the winners was center Bodian Massa (205-97) who had a double-double by scoring 14 points and 10 rebounds. Cuban power forward Grismay Paumier (205-88) chipped in 5 points and 14 rebounds. Saint Chamond's coach Alain Thinet allowed to play the deep bench players saving starting five for next games. American forward Jordan Tolbert (201-92, college: SMU) produced a double-double by scoring 14 points and 13 rebounds and his fellow American import point guard Jerrold Brooks (183-91, college: S.Mississippi) added 19 points and 5 assists respectively for the guests. Saint Chamond maintains fifth position with 17-9 record, which they share with Rouen. Loser Caen keeps the seventeenth place with 19 games lost. Saint Chamond will meet higher ranked Sluc Nancy (#4) on the road in the next round and it may be quite challenging game. Caen will play against the league's second-placed JA Vichy (#2) and hope to secure a win.
